            CYB123 – Cybersecurity Threats and Defense              
            
Cybersecurity Threats and Defense
Dates: 3/24/2026 – 5/15/2026
Course Times:Tuesday & Thursday: 4:15-6:30 pm
Modality: In-Person
Address: One ÎÚÑ»´«Ã½ Tech Blvd, East Greenwich, RI 02818This course provides a broad overview of the field of cybersecurity. The course covers history, terminology and strategies involved in securing information assets and serves as a foundation course for more advanced studies in information, network and computer security. General and specific threats to information assets and defensive strategies for protecting those assets are covered. The course employs an integrated system of skill-building lessons, hands-on exercises, and self-assessment tools.

            TT106 – Introduction to Vehicle Maintenance              
            
Introduction to Vehicle Maintenance
Dates: 3/24/2026 – 5/15/2026
Course Times:Tuesday & Thursday: 4:15-6:30 pm
Modality: In-Person
Address:Access Rd Campus, 110 Access Rd, Warwick, RI 02886This course is designed to familiarize incoming students with the operations of the Transportation Labs and the overall program. Students will be introduced to shop safety procedures, various types of hand tools and their uses, measuring tools and shop equipment such as lifts and scan tools. In addition, the various fasteners that will be encountered in the program will be explained and their uses discussed. Through a combination of both classroom and lab work, students will also be exposed to various basic vehicle maintenance checks and procedures. Students will also practice online information and data retrieval as well as recording-keeping. Students will be introduced to a wide range of potential career opportunities and work environments in the automotive field. Students will be asked to demonstrate proficiency using shop equipment such as lifts, jacks, jack stands and jump packs.
